It is better to understand the meaning of web development first. Web development encompasses a wide arena of activities concerned with the development of the website for the World Wide Web or the Intranet. This technique involves ecommerce business development, web design, client-side / server-side coding, web design etc.
When a website is built, it involves several design as well as non-design aspects. For software professional, web development refers to the non-design aspects of developing a website. Web development has a wide range of activities and can serve the purpose of developing a single static page to complex web applications.
Web development requires tremendous technical proficiency, which is owned by skilled and dedicated software professionals. Web development has come a long way since its evolution. It is one of the rapidly growing industries in the world. The tremendous pace of growth of this sector can be attributed to those big corporate houses that intend to sell their products and services to their customers and also to the countless web designing and hosting companies operating all around the globe.
Web development has given rise to a revolutionary trend of internet applications via ecommerce solutions. Online transactions, shopping, banking etc are all so easy now due to ecommerce solutions. Apart from this, web development has also given rise to a new concept i.e., blog. Web development has succeeded in extending into new modes of communication via open source content systems such as Typo3, Xoops etc.
Web development also deals with other important aspects such as security. Components such as data entry error checking through forms are worked upon only by web development. It should be clear that the professional who carries out all these tasks is known as web developer. A web developer is entrusted with other professional responsibilities such as graphic designing or web designing, copywriting, project management, quality assurance etc.
